Why You Need Asynchronous Transfer Mode
Asynchronous transfer mode or ATM is a cell based switching strategy which has brought an evolution in the communication systems of today and are associated to networking. This consists of a great deal of excellent features and can operate on both LAN and WAN connections.
A lot of us are familiar with the word ATM however we hardly understand anything about its performance or how it works. We hardly even understand what this abbreviation stands for. Well ATM especially means asynchronous transfer mode and can be defined as a generally cell based switching method which particularly makes the use of asynchronous time division multiplexing that makes it possible for encoding of certain data into certain sized cells or cell relay and provides certain information connect layer services which specifically operate on OSI Layer 1 physical links. Well usually people puzzle it with package switched networks like the Internet Protocol or Ethernet where various sized small packets are made use of for data transfer.
ATM or asynchronous transfer mode normally possesses properties of both types of networking, suggesting it can be made use of in both circuit switched along with packet switched over networking which could act as the best ways of a wide range of information transfer. It is also extremely suitable for real time media transportation. The design which is specifically utilized in this specific mode of data transfer is primarily connection oriented, thus easily joins the two end points with virtual circuit even before the data begins moving.
